What medium are you using for veg/bloom.

If its soil or coco, drop the seed right in. Or sprouted seed in your case.

If it's hydro, toss it into a rockwool cube and then into hydroton or grow rocks.

You should consider only flowering a few at a time so you have a steady supply and also dont go over your limits on your first havest.
I would recommend you do half your plants in hydro like you planned and half in soil or peat/coco and see which method best suits you.hydro can go south real quick if your not on your game at all times.
but yes you can put those rr plugs directly into your hydroton rocks or even soil.good luck my fellow michigan weed grower.peace
